Step 1
Whisk eggs, oil and sugar in a bowl. Fold through carrots and walnuts. In a second b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der and spices. Add to wet mixture and fold until just combined.
Step 2
Heat pie maker. Spray or brush cooking plates lightly with oil. Scoop 1/3 cup measures into plates, close lid and bake for 8 minutes until a skewer inserted into the center comes out clean. Remove and repeat with remaining batter.
Step 3
For icing, whisk together cream cheese and butter until smooth. Add sifted icing sugar and whip until fluffy. Whisk through vanilla.
Step 4
To assemble cakes, use a sharp serrated knife to slice a thin layer off the rounded top off four of the cakes. Spread a thick layer of icing over the cut edge then top with an uncut cake. Ice the top of the double layered cake and, if you like, ice the sides as well.
Step 5
Sprinkle with some extra chopped walnuts.
